Get ready for a Singapore fling – Fairfax Media launches Young Spikes competitions
Entries are now open for the Fairfax Media Young Spikes Integrated and Young Spikes Media Competitions. Entries are due
by 17 July and the two winning teams will be sent to Singapore to compete at the Asia Pacific region’s foremost creative
communications festival, Spikes Asia.
This year, Fairfax Media is the official representative for Spikes Asia in New Zealand. Following consistent market
feedback about the growing importance of regional campaigns, we have committed to sending two teams to compete in the
Young Spikes Competitions and help promote Spikes Asia with the New Zealand industry.

About Spikes
The Spikes Asia Festival is a collaboration between Cannes Lions and Haymarket. The Festival provides the region’s
growing creative communications industry with a platform to network and exchange ideas.
The Spike Asia Awards are the region’s oldest and most prestigious awards for creative communications. They reward the
best entries in Film, Print, Outdoor, Radio, Digital, Direct, Promo & Activation, Media, Design, Film Craft, Print & Poster Craft, Integrated, Mobile, PR, Branded Content & Entertainment and Creative Effectiveness.
The entries are judged by leading international and regional creatives in Singapore during the week of the Festival.
